Apart from your most frequently used and recently used suggestions, you are also shown app suggestions that you can download, depending upon your usage and browsing history. This change is made to match the position of the taskbar icons with the overall design and layout of the windows 11 plan. Now, it is aligned towards the center and still remains to be the first icon. In 10, the start button is towards the left bottom corner and the first icon on the taskbar. If we compare the status of the Start Menu in the older Windows 10 version and the new Windows 11 version, there are quite a few notable differences.įirstly, the position of the Windows 10 Start menu is different from where it is placed in the windows 11 version.
